607 Sqn Pilots 1942
Can anyone tell me the initials or christian name of WO Dutraky and Plt Off MacDonald who were with 607 in the UK early 1942? Former's name might be incorrectly spelled
|
Re: 607 Sqn Pilots 1942
Peter MacDonald (RAAF 404687).
/John Engelsted |
Re: 607 Sqn Pilots 1942
Thanks John. Going back into 1941 in the ORB shows P MacDonald (Aus); killed 11 Mar 43
